Transaction e72f2fed45fae950ee205145f8150e03569d435974b5433a6a93cd32a9310287
1 Input
2 Outputs
- e72f2fed45fae950ee205145f8150e03569d435974b5433a6a93cd32a9310287:0
- e72f2fed45fae950ee205145f8150e03569d435974b5433a6a93cd32a9310287:1
value 146969
address 1MtDS4WpCWW8NQPkcVxS9gRgZ6FYkxFmpZ
value 830757
address 12hmC7UGL5LBvNEa67BC8KCrFVtSqN123Z